Arnold & Son: Elegance at Watches & Wonders 2026
Arnold & Son’s 2026 collection showcases a blend of material‑driven design and ultra‑thin mechanics, highlighted by the HM Pietersite and the Ultrathin Tourbillon Onyx. The HM Pietersite features a pietersite dial that evokes stormy landscapes, offered in limited editions of 18‑carat red gold (8 pieces) and stainless steel (18 pieces). Its 39.5 mm case, 7.82 mm thickness, and hand‑wound A&S1001 movement provide a 90‑hour power reserve, while the design emphasizes simplicity, historical references, and refined finishing. The Ultrathin Tourbillon Onyx pushes the limits of thinness with a hand‑wound A&S8300 caliber, a flying one‑minute tourbillon, and a 100‑hour power reserve. Limited to eight pieces each in 18‑carat rose gold and platinum, the watch houses an onyx dial finished in matte and satin textures, creating a striking contrast with the polished tourbillon cage. Measuring 41.5 mm in diameter and 8.4 mm in height, it offers water resistance up to three bar and prices around $95,000 for the rose‑gold version and $109,000 for the platinum edition.
